SMITH v. HUNTINGTON PUB. CO.

Civ. A. No. 9010.

410 F.Supp. 1270 (1975)

Harold Randall SMITH, a minor by Evelyn Smith, his mother and next friend, and Evelyn Smith, Plaintiffs, v. HUNTINGTON PUBLISHING COMPANY, Defendant.

United States District Court, S. D. Ohio, W. D.

May 5, 1975.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Lloyd E. Moore, Ironton, Ohio, for plaintiffs.

Paul R. Moran, Cincinnati, Ohio, for defendant.


MEMO ON DEFENDANT'S MOTION FOR SUMMARY JUDGMENT

TIMOTHY S. HOGAN, Chief Judge.

This is an action for damages which was removed from the Court of Common Pleas, Lawrence County, Ohio. The plaintiffs, Harold Randall Smith, a minor, and Evelyn Smith, his mother, claim that the defendant, Huntington Publishing Co., published an allegedly libelous article on October 5, 1973, which, it is claimed, defamed them.
